React native bundle 分包

WebJan 31, 2024 · 9. The bundle is indeed 'the javascript'. In development the bundle likely will come from your react-native start development server. That way if your code is changed the server will send a request to the client, through a websocket, to download the new code or update the code on the fly. So, you could say the bundle is dynamically generated ... WebMar 9, 2024 · react-native bundle是react-native-cli的一个命令,制作离线包需要用到react-native bundle命令行,我们先来了解下react-native bundle可选参数都有哪些,如果熟悉webpack打包的朋友对下面的参数会很熟悉:. --entry-file :配置入口JS文件路径,可以是绝对路径,也可以是相对于 ...

cli React Native Developer Tools - GitHub Pages

Web第一次安装运行RN项目时,执行react-native run-ios 报如上图“No bundle URL present”错误。 谷歌了下各种解决方案: // 项目在模拟器运行状态执行如下代码: npm install react-native run-ios WebJun 16, 2024 · 将bundle分为两部分,在内存中先执行基础模块的定义,然后再需要打开页面时,执行该页面的业务模块文件; 优点:性能好,能优化执行时间; 缺点:成本大, 需要 … how many gallons does a lexus rx 350 hold https://avantidetailing.com

React Native 分包实践_mazaiting的博客-CSDN博客

Web我正在使用 React Native 和集成库 react-native-obfuscating-transformer混淆我的代码.现在反编译我的 APK 后,我相信我的整个 js 代码都在 assets/index.android.bundle 下.. 我如何将它解包并查看我的代码是否进行了混淆处理. 推荐答案 For Macbook brew install apktool Web而上文示例的10000.js业务包是通过 react-native bundle命令生成的。 因此再来了解bundle 和unbundle在加载过程中有什么区别。 如上图代码所示,RN判断Js模块是否是unbundle的打包方式时, 只是判断 asset的js-modules目录下是否有一个固定字符的UNBUNDLE文件。 Web本文是基于react-native 0.55, react 16.3.1版本展开. 目的. 减少业务包体积(app瘦身) 节省热更新流量; 提升模块加载速度; 实现方式. 打通用包,包括react-native框架、code-push框架、常用第三方框架、rnlib代码等; 打全量bundle包; 全量包基于通用包打出差异包(业务包) how many gallons does a car have

React-Native 离线bundle - 腾讯云开发者社区-腾讯云

Category:React-Native 离线bundle - 腾讯云开发者社区-腾讯云

Tags:React native bundle 分包

React native bundle 分包

Bundling React Native during Android release builds

我们的react-native项目中,一张图片一般会存在1x, 1.5x, 2x, 3x几种尺寸(1.5x是android特有的),以便在不同 ... WebJun 15, 2024 · react-native bundle是RN的将js代码打包成jsbundle命令。. 具体使用方式不再赘述,可以通过react-native bundle -help查看。. 对index.js进行打包,执行:. react …

React native bundle 分包

Did you know?

Web输入以下命令可以在设备上安装发行版本:. $ npx react-native run-android --variant=release. 注意 --variant=release 参数只能在你完成了上面的签名配置之后才可以使用。. 你现在可 … WebMay 20, 2024 · Уменьшение размера React Native-приложения на 60% за несколько простых шагов ... Для этого мы воспользовались отличным опенсорсным инструментом react-native-bundle-visualizer. Проанализировав с его помощью ...

WebApr 9, 2024 · AppRegistry 负责注册运行 React Native 应用程序的 JaveScript 入口,程序入口组件使用 AppRegistry.registerComponent 来注册。. 当注册完应用程序组件后, Native 系统(OC)就会加载 jsbundle 文件并触发 AppRegistry.runApplication 运行应用。. AppRegistry 接口有以下方法:. registerConfig ... WebReact Native 的动态化方案,都难以脱离一个分包。React Native 的基础库不小,再加上我们需要的一些依赖,比如 React-Native-Vector-Icons 这样的公共依赖,这些不常改变的依 …

WebApr 14, 2024 · On Windows, you can use the gradlew executable made for Bash, unless you install WSL for Windows (which is highly recommended for many other reasons, so then your ./gradlew would just work in the WSL shell).Without WSL, you need to use the gradlew.bat file instead, which should be in your android folder in your repo as its included in the react … WebAug 25, 2024 · npm install -g yarn react-native-cli 检测是否安装成功 2.创建rn项目(注意:项目名不能有中文路径) react-native init 项目名 --version 0.55.4 (要求必须跟上版本号) 例如:react-native init rn_demo --version 0.55.4 等待下载完毕即可... 3.启动手机(或者手机模拟 …

WebReact Native brings React 's declarative UI framework to iOS and Android. With React Native, you use native UI controls and have full access to the native platform. Declarative. React makes it painless to create interactive UIs. Declarative views make your code more predictable and easier to debug.

WebMar 9, 2024 · react-native-cli 自带脚本可以打包 react-native bundle 命令. 以下是命令的参数说明: react-native bundle –entry-file ,ios或者android入口的js名称 –platform ,平台名称(ios或者android) –dev ,设置为false的时候将会对JavaScript代码进行优化处理 how many gallons does a f1 car holdWebReact Native for Web is a compatibility layer between React DOM and React Native. It can be used in new and existing apps, web-only and multi-platform apps. React Native for Web uses React DOM to accurately render React Native compatible JavaScript code in a web browser. This brings several powerful abstractions to web developers include a ... how many gallons does a goldfish needWebModule定义:使用__d()函数定义所有用到的模块,该函数为每个模块赋予了一个模块ID,模块之间的依赖关系都是通过这个ID进行关联的。 Require调用:使用__r()函数引用根模块 … how many gallons does a honda holdWebApp configuration is a declarative, structured way to express these decisions as defaults for how your app is bundled. All the knowledge is captured in one easy-to-read format, without duplication. Take a look at this example iOS bundling command: react-native rnx-bundle \. --entry-file index.js \. --platform ios \. how many gallons does a matv holdWeb众所周知,react-native(下文简称rn) 需要打成 bundle 包供 android,ios 加载;通常我们的打包命令为 react-native bundle --entry-file index.js --bundle-output ./bundle/ios.bundle --platform ios --assets-dest ./bundle --dev false;运行上述命令之后,rn 会默认使用 metro 作为打包工具,生成 bundle 包。 how many gallons does an he washer useWebOct 16, 2024 · react-native-webpack-toolkit是下一代产品, 是一个用于React Native应用程序的基于Webpack的捆绑器。 react-native-webpack-toolkit使用Webpack 5和React Native … how many gallons does a gt 500 holdWebMay 9, 2016 · 要做好 React Native 的热更新,主要需要处理好如下几个情况:. 本地启动:为保证启动速度,不能全部依赖线上的 bundle,需保证还未下载到 bundle 的时候,能如常载入 bundle 并启动,所以初始化 RCTBridge 或 RCTRootView 时用的 bundleURL 得指向本地而非网络;. 及时更新 ... how many gallons does a hummer hold